HyperLiquid API Glitch: Refunds and a Cautionary Tale
HyperLiquid recently faced a surge in API traffic, leading to delayed order updates, user confusion, and financial losses. The platform issued refunds to affected traders, igniting a debate about industry standards and the need for robust infrastructure.
The API Meltdown: What Happened?
On July 29, 2025, HyperLiquid's API servers buckled under the weight of a sudden traffic spike, causing a near 27-minute trading halt. Users reported frozen front-end systems, making it impossible to open, close positions, execute trades, or withdraw funds. While the underlying decentralized exchange (DEX) and blockchain network remained operational, the centralized front-end failure exposed critical vulnerabilities.
Even though trades were being successfully submitted, misleading error messages left users in the dark, creating real financial consequences. HyperLiquid acknowledged the disruption and initiated refunds, aiming to recreate worst-case exit scenarios for fair compensation.
Refunds: Basic Decency or Above and Beyond?
HyperLiquid's decision to refund users sparked mixed reactions. Some hailed it as “world class,” praising the proactive approach in a situation where there was no legal obligation to compensate. Others argued that refunds should be the bare minimum after a technical failure.
One user's remark, “The fact that the industry thinks this is incredible just shows how disgusting crypto has become,” encapsulates the sentiment that reliability should be a given, not a celebrated exception.
HYPE Token: Recovery and Lingering Caution
The HYPE token experienced an immediate 5% decline following the outage. While it partially recovered, investor sentiment remains strained. Technical indicators also suggest a cautious outlook.
At the time of writing, HYPE was trading around $39.39 with a 1.6% daily gain, but the RSI remains below the neutral 50, and the CMF is negative, indicating continued capital outflows. Price candles hovering below the Bollinger Band midline suggest limited bullish strength.
Front-End Vulnerabilities: A DeFi-Wide Issue
HyperLiquid's experience mirrors similar incidents in the DeFi space. Curve Finance faced a DNS hijacking, and Ethena Labs and Balancer experienced front-end compromises. These events highlight the irony of decentralized platforms relying on centralized infrastructure for user interaction.
Critics argue that this duality creates systemic risks. Attackers have exploited DNS vulnerabilities to manipulate user access, and traffic spikes can paralyze trading activity, even if the underlying blockchain remains functional.
Looking Ahead: Scalability and Reliability
HyperLiquid's response to the outage included a swift restoration of API services and transparent communication via social media. However, the incident raises questions about contingency planning for high-traffic scenarios and the ability to balance scalability with reliability.
As the DeFi sector evolves, platforms must address these architectural trade-offs to maintain trust. For now, HYPE's volatility reflects investor sensitivity to operational risks, a factor likely to influence the token's long-term performance and HyperLiquid's competitive positioning.
